Specialty Teas

Green Tea
Our green tea is made from mature tea leaves that undergo minimal oxidation before processing. It is dried instead of being fermented, making it a very healthy and relaxing drink with a natural taste.
White Tea
White tea is the most premium of all our teas. It derives its name from the silver-white hair on the unopened buds. Our white tea is from the finest hand-picked buds and young leaves of the tea plant, without undergoing any fermentation at all.
Purple Tea
Purple tea is obtained from a purple-leafed varietal of the tea plant. Our purple tea undergoes minimal oxidation and fermentation before being heated and dried. Purple tea has more antioxidants than any of our other teas.
Orthodox Tea
Black orthodox is oxidized tea produced through rolling machines. Black Orthodox grading is by leaf size, texture and style.
